Participation Criteria
Eligibility Criteria
Ages Eligible for Study
Accepts Healthy Volunteers
Genders Eligible for Study
Description
Inclusion Criteria:
- Age (years): 20-65
- Body Mass Index (kg/m2): 28-35
- Non-smokers
Exclusion Criteria:
- Subjects using prescription medication, or suffering from diseases or conditions that might influence the outcome of the study: this concerns diseases/medication that influence body weight regulation (malabsorption, untreated hypo/hyperthyroidism, eating disorders, systemic use of steroids, etc.) and obesity-related cardiovascular risk factors (heart disease, systolic and diastolic blood pressures > 160/100 mmHg, blood glucose > 6.1 mmol L-1, blood cholesterol > 7 mmol L-1, blood triglycerides > 3 mmol L-1)
- marked alcohol consumption > 21 alcoholic units week-1 (male), or >14 alcoholic units week-1 (female)
- planned major changes in physical activity during the study to an extent that might interfere with the study outcome as judged by the investigator;
- blood donation within the past 2 months prior to the study
- weight change of >3 kg within 2 months prior to the study
- psychiatric disease (based on medical history only)
- pregnant or lactating women, or women planning to become pregnant within the next 12 months
- surgically treated obesity
- participation in other clinical studies within the last 3 months
- drug abuse (based on clinical judgment)
- unable to give informed consent
- unable to engage in a low-calorie diet
- unable to lose more then 8% of body weight after weight-loss period
- following a special diet (vegetarian, Atkins or other).
Study Plan
How is the study designed?
Design Details
- Primary Purpose: Prevention
- Allocation: Randomized
- Interventional Model: Parallel Assignment
- Masking: Single
Arms and Interventions
Participant Group / Arm |
Intervention / Treatment |
|---|---|
|
Experimental: Very Low Calorie Diet
|
modifast intensive diet replacing all regular meals (500 kcal/d) for 5 weeks
|
|
Active Comparator: Low Calorie Diet
1250 kcal diet in which Modifast is given in combination with a normal diet
|
Combination of modifast and regular diet (1250 kcal/d) for 3 months
